导读:在MySQL中,数字的格式化是一项非常重要的操作 。它可以帮助我们更好地呈现和管理数据,使得数据更加易于阅读和理解 。本文将介绍如何使用MySQL对数字进行格式化,包括保留小数位数、添加千位分隔符等操作 。
1. 使用ROUND函数保留小数位数
ROUND函数可以将一个数字四舍五入到指定的小数位数 。例如,如果我们想将一个数字保留两位小数,可以使用以下语句:
SELECT ROUND(123.456,2);
这将返回123.46 。
2. 使用FORMAT函数添加千位分隔符
FORMAT函数可以将一个数字格式化为带有千位分隔符的形式 。例如,如果我们想将一个数字格式化为每三位添加一个逗号的形式,可以使用以下语句:
SELECT FORMAT(1234567.89,0);
这将返回1,234,567 。
3. 将格式化后的数字作为字符串输出
如果我们想将格式化后的数字作为字符串输出,可以将FORMAT函数与CONCAT函数结合使用 。例如,如果我们想将一个数字格式化为每三位添加一个逗号,并且在前面添加“$”符号 , 可以使用以下语句:
SELECT CONCAT('$',FORMAT(1234567.89,0));
这将返回$1,234,567 。
【mysql格式化时分秒 mysql格式化数字】总结:MySQL提供了多种方式来格式化数字,包括保留小数位数、添加千位分隔符等操作 。这些操作可以帮助我们更好地呈现和管理数据,使得数据更加易于阅读和理解 。